Quick Answer
Eco-friendly invitation cards are wedding and event invitations made from sustainable materials such as seed paper, recycled pulp, handmade Lokta paper, or bamboo fibre, produced without plastic lamination or toxic inks. In Chennai, they typically cost between ₹35 and ₹250 per card depending on material and customisation. They decompose naturally or can be planted by guests, making them a responsible and increasingly popular choice for modern Indian weddings.
What Makes Eco-Friendly Invitation Cards Different From Conventional Ones?
Conventional wedding cards in Chennai are usually printed on virgin wood-pulp paper, finished with PVC lamination, and embellished with non-recyclable foil, making them destined for landfill within minutes of being read. Eco-friendly invitation cards replace every one of those elements. The base material is either recycled paper wedding cards stock made from post-consumer waste, handmade Lokta paper sourced from Nepal, bamboo fibre sheets, or plantable seed paper impregnated with wildflower or tulsi seeds. Inks are vegetable-based or soy-based, free from volatile organic compounds. Finishing touches such as jute twine, dried marigold petals, and terracotta elephant motifs are fully compostable. The result is a card that carries the same festive warmth as a traditional Tamil wedding invite but leaves virtually no carbon footprint. For Chennai families who are already choosing organic catering menus and renting reusable décor, making the switch to biodegradable invitation stationery is a natural and visible extension of those values.
Popular Material Choices and Their Price Range in Chennai
Seed paper is the most talked-about option right now. Plantable seed paper invites are embedded with marigold, basil, or wildflower seeds; after the wedding, guests press the card into soil and water it to watch flowers or herbs grow — a keepsake that doubles as a memory. Prices in Chennai start around ₹80 per card for a single A5 sheet with basic letterpress printing, rising to ₹200–₹250 for multi-insert sets with handcrafted envelopes. Recycled paper wedding cards are the most affordable entry point, typically ₹35–₹90 per card, and work beautifully with screen printing or digital offset. Handmade Lokta paper cards, prized for their featherweight texture and natural deckle edges, cost ₹100–₹180 per card and suit Tamil Brahmin or Iyer-style weddings where understated elegance is valued. Biodegradable invitation stationery made from banana fibre or sugarcane bagasse pulp is an emerging niche in the city, priced similarly to Lokta, and often sourced from artisan clusters in Coimbatore or Pondicherry. Bulk orders above 300 cards generally attract a 15–20 per cent discount from most Chennai studios.
How Do Sustainable Wedding Invitations Fit Into Chennai's Wedding Culture?
Tamil weddings are known for their elaborate stationery traditions — multi-fold cards, separate inserts for the muhurtham, reception, and Nalangu, and sometimes a hand-delivered silver thamboolam box. Sustainable wedding invitations are now being designed with exactly this structure in mind. Studios in T. Nagar and Anna Nagar offer multi-panel eco-friendly invitation cards printed on recycled card stock, complete with separate muhurtham slips on seed paper. The outer envelope can be a handwoven cotton pocket with a wax seal instead of a plastic window. For weddings held at heritage sabhas in Mylapore or garden venues in ECR, the natural earthy aesthetic of these cards complements the venue's own character. Designers also integrate QR codes linking to digital RSVP pages, which supports zero-waste wedding planning by reducing the need for extra paper inserts. This digital-physical hybrid invite approach is especially appreciated by guests with children who love the planting activity later.

✅ Pre-booking Checklist
- Finalise your guest count before requesting quotes — order volumes directly affect per-card pricing.
- Request physical material samples for every paper type before confirming your order.
- Confirm that the printer uses vegetable-based or soy-based inks for all eco-friendly invitation cards.
- Plan a 4–6 week lead time for handmade or seed paper variants; book earlier during peak wedding seasons (November–February).
- Clarify whether multi-insert sets — muhurtham slip, reception card, RSVP — are included in the quoted price.
- Discuss QR code integration for digital RSVPs to reduce the need for additional paper inserts.
- Verify compostable or recyclable packaging for the cards to maintain end-to-end sustainability.
- Get a written proof approved — in both Tamil and English text if bilingual — before the full print run begins.
🎯 Selection Criteria
- Material certification: confirm the paper is genuinely recycled, handmade, or seed-embedded, not merely unlaminated conventional stock.
- Ink safety: soy or vegetable-based inks are essential; avoid studios that use solvent-based inks on eco cards.
- Artisan provenance: prefer studios that source from verified handmade paper clusters in Tamil Nadu, Pondicherry, or certified fair-trade suppliers.
- Design flexibility: ensure the studio can typeset Tamil script accurately and handle multi-insert layouts.
- Turnaround reliability: confirm the studio's peak-season capacity before committing to a delivery date.
- Packaging integrity: the outer packaging should be equally sustainable to maintain the card's overall eco credentials.
💰 Cost / Quality Factors
- Paper type is the single biggest cost driver — seed paper costs roughly 2–3x more than basic recycled stock.
- Printing method affects both price and appearance — letterpress adds texture and cost; digital offset suits dense Tamil typography.
- Customisation depth (custom artwork, foil-free embossing, hand-calligraphy) increases cost and production time significantly.
- Order volume — bulk discounts typically kick in at 300 cards, making large weddings more cost-efficient per unit.
- Packaging choice — compostable jute or kraft envelopes add ₹10–₹30 per set but complete the eco narrative.
- Delivery logistics — fragile handmade papers need padded kraft packaging for courier, adding a small but real per-unit cost.
⚠️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Ordering from an online marketplace without requesting a physical sample first — screen images never capture the true paper texture.
- Assuming any unlaminated card qualifies as eco-friendly — always verify the base material and ink type explicitly.
- Underestimating lead time for handmade papers and missing the postal or courier dispatch window for outstation guests.
- Neglecting bilingual Tamil-English proofing, which leads to costly reprints on premium handmade stock.
- Choosing seed paper for a large 800-guest wedding without a hybrid strategy — costs escalate rapidly without a plan.
- Ignoring packaging: a sustainable card in a plastic-wrapped box undermines the entire eco-friendly positioning.
